Late 19th Century French Provencial Walnut Table with Drawer
This is a charming antique walnut farmhouse table, dating back to the Late 19th century. Rectangular top sits atop four square tapered legs, which look to have had an earlier extension added for height. The finish on the top has been worn through creating a particularly rustic but beautiful patina, reflecting years of use and history. A single drawer, discreetly integrated beneath the tabletop, provides convenient storage.
30.5" deep x 66.38" wide x 29.5" high
24" high bottom of apron to the floor.
1 drawer
Condition : Structurally sound. Top finish is completely worn through creating a rustic aged look reflecting its age and history. The top has markings, worn scratches, discolorations, water marks and general aging from use. An earlier addition of wood was added to the legs to make it taller.
